Ellington Properties wins three Arabian Property Awards 2016

Monday 10 October 2016

Dubai - MENA Herald: Ellington Properties, a design-led boutique property development company creating bespoke and beautiful high-quality homes, has won three times at the recent Arabian Property Awards 2016, a glittering event held at the JW Marriott Marquis Dubai.

Ellington won their first award for ‘Architecture - Multiple Residence’ for its exclusive DT1 tower, a 22 storey 130 residence tower in Downtown Dubai designed by Perkins+Will Architects.

Ellington also won two more awards for both the ‘Architecture & Interior Design - Single Residence’ for The Ellington Collection at Palm Island, a series of luxury villas on Palm Jumeirah designed by MDR Architects from California with interior design by Pallavi Dean of Dubai.

The company will now go forward along with other winners to represent Dubai in the 2016-2017 International Property Awards held in London on December 12th. One of these winners from each category will receive the prestigious title of ‘Arabia’s Best’ and compete against other regional winners from Africa, Arabia, the USA, Canada, Caribbean, Central and South America, Asia Pacific and Europe to find the ultimate World’s Best in each category.

Earlier this year, Ellington announced 14 developments in Dubai which will add over 2,000 residential units through apartments, townhouses and villas.

The company jointly set up by industry veterans Robert Booth and Joseph Thomas already has over 2 million square feet in GFA under design and construction. The firm manages everything from design stage to full construction across property development, advisory and rental units development.

Robert Booth, Managing Director, Ellington Properties, said: “Ellington’s story has developed alongside that of Dubai’s in the last two years. To be recognised by the Arabian Property Awards is reflective of our discerning customers who appreciate design and quality over price points.”

Ellington Properties first project is nearing completion, Belgravia in Jumeirah Village Circle, an exclusive, low-rise building with 181 residences overlooking a resort style swimming pool, beautiful landscape courtyards and a children’s play area, close to sports fields, parks, and schools
